The Fire Marshal Division is responsible
for the local fire code enforcement for 12 Ocean County municipalities:
Barnegat Light, Beach Haven, Bay Head, Harvey Cedars, Lakewood, Long
Beach Township, Plumsted Township, Point Pleasant Borough, Seaside
Park, Ship Bottom, South Toms River and Surf City. Duties in these
municipalities include fire inspections of commercial establishments,
enforcement of the state Fire Code and investigation of
fires. In addition to these municipalities, the Fire Marshal's
Office is responsible for inspecting all County-owned buildings, regardless
of their location.
The Fire Marshal's Office also responds to fire
scenes in every municipality, except Brick and Dover Townships,
to investigate fires as to cause and origin and also works with
the Prosecutor's Office.
The Fire Marshal's Office operated a "Kid's Fire Safety House"
which is a trailer designed to teach children how to escape from smoke-filled
rooms and how to spot potential fire hazards. This program reaches
over 12,000 children annually at schools, the county Fair, and other
public places. The Office also reaches out to schools during Fire
Safety Week in October of each year with a fire safety program.
